Re “A Different Valor” (by Henry Chu, Dec. 7): I hope the “200 photographers, painters and poets” who urged their fellow artists to boycott Israel because “the world must speak out against Israeli war crimes and atrocities” took the trouble to include in their Internet petition the following countries too: Algeria, Argentina, Angola, Azerbaijan, Burma, Colombia, China, Chile, Croatia, Egypt, Eritrea, El Salvador, Guatemala, Iraq, Indonesia, Iran, India, Ivory Coast, Lebanon, Liberia, Malaysia, Mauritania, Morocco, Nepal/Bhutan, Pakistan, Peru, Russia, Saudi Arabia, Sudan, Sri Lanka, Syria, Tunisia, Ukraine, Uzbekistan, Vietnam, to name a few. Human Rights Watch 2003 cites these and many others who daily violate the rights of their citizens, prisoners of war and refugees based on gender, religion, political opposition or sexual orientation.

Israel is trying to protect its innocent civilians from being blown up by a murderous enemy. They are building a wall to stop murderers from entering, not to prevent innocent civilians from leaving.

I am sure that, because those artists are so offended by Israel’s policies, they must be positively outraged at the unprovoked and cruel war crimes and atrocities occurring in the above and many other countries every single day .
